The NIO EL8 (SUV) is powered by a Electric engine and comes with a Automatic transmission. In comparison, the Citroen C5 Aircross (SUV) features a Diesel, Plugin Hybrid or Petrol MHEV engine and a Automatic gearbox.
When it comes to boot capacity, the NIO EL8 offers 265 L, while the Citroen C5 Aircross provides 580 L – depending on what matters most to you. If you’re looking for more power, you’ll need to decide whether the 653 HP of the NIO EL8 or the 224 HP of the Citroen C5 Aircross suits your needs better.
There are also differences in efficiency: 21.20 kWh vs 1.40 L. In terms of price, the NIO EL8 starts at 71100 £, while the Citroen C5 Aircross is available from 29200 £.

The NIO EL8 stands as a testament to the future of electric vehicles, with its impressive power, top-tier technology, and sustainable design. As an all-electric SUV, the NIO EL8 is designed to offer a thrilling yet environmentally friendly driving experience, making it a compelling choice for those in the market for a premium electric vehicle.
Under the bonnet, the NIO EL8 boasts a formidable 653 PS, which translates to an impressive 480 kW of power. This power is efficiently distributed to all four wheels through an automatic transmission, ensuring optimal traction and handling in various driving conditions. With a peak torque of 850 Nm, the NIO EL8 delivers exhilarating acceleration, reaching 0-100 km/h in just 4.1 seconds.
Making no compromises on range, the NIO EL8 offers two variants: the Long Range, with an impressive 510 km on a single charge, and the Standard Range variant, which offers 390 km. This is achieved with an energy consumption of 21.2 - 22 kWh/100 km, positioning the EL8 as one of the most efficient SUVs in its class. This incredible efficiency is supported by a battery capacity ranging from 73.5 to 90 kWh, catering to diverse driving needs.
The technological prowess of the NIO EL8 is evident in its cutting-edge features. It integrates advanced software to enhance driving experience and safety, including autonomous driving capabilities and intelligent navigation systems. This seamless integration of technology ensures not just a smooth drive, but also a safer one.
With its luxurious design, the NIO EL8 offers ample space with 6 comfortable seats, embracing both functionality and aesthetics. Standing tall at 1750 mm and extending to 5099 mm in length, the EL8 presents a commanding road presence, complemented by its sleek exterior. The spacious interior and attention to detail ensure passenger comfort, making every journey a pleasure.
In an era where sustainability is crucial, the NIO EL8 delivers on zero emissions, boasting a CO2 efficiency class of A, with no CO2 emissions per km. This commitment to environmental responsibility is coupled with a revolutionary approach to EV design and production, ensuring that the NIO EL8 is as environmentally conscious as it is powerful.
The NIO EL8 is competitively priced between €82,900 and €105,900, offering an option for almost every budget within the premium electric vehicle segment. Buyers can opt for variations with included battery or those requiring battery rental, providing flexibility and choice.

Citroën has long been synonymous with comfort and innovation, and the C5 Aircross is no exception. Positioned as a premium SUV, it brings a seamless blend of style and technology. In this article, we'll explore the technical specifics and standout innovations that make the C5 Aircross a compelling choice in its segment.
With the C5 Aircross, Citroën offers an impressive array of engine choices to suit varying preferences. The range includes efficient diesel models, petrol mild hybrids, and advanced plug-in hybrid variants. The plug-in hybrid model stands out with a combined power output of 224 PS, a remarkable fuel consumption rate of 1.4 L/100 km, and an electric range of 58 km, further enhancing fuel efficiency and reducing carbon footprint.
The C5 Aircross is engineered for smooth driving experiences with its automatic transmission options. Customers can choose between conventional automatic and a sophisticated dual-clutch transmission system. The front-wheel-drive configuration ensures optimal handling, making urban traffic and country roads a breeze, supported by a robust output ranging from 96 to 165 kW.
Designed with a focus on comfort, the C5 Aircross offers a spacious interior that accommodates five passengers with ease. With a boot capacity ranging from 460 to 580 litres, practicality is guaranteed for family adventures. Additionally, the vehicle boasts top-tier technology, including advanced infotainment systems and modern safety features, ensuring an enjoyable and secure journey.
Citroën remains committed to environmental responsibility, reflected in the C5 Aircross' CO2 efficiency. The plug-in hybrid models demonstrate superior eco-friendliness with emissions as low as 32 g/km. The integration of a 12.9 kWh battery underlines Citroën's dedication to reducing environmental impact while maintaining performance standards.
Despite its premium positioning, the C5 Aircross remains accessible with a price range from €33,270 to €48,660, catering to various budgets without compromising on quality. Furthermore, the monthly costs remain competitive, making this SUV an attractive proposition for both personal and commercial use.
